Chapter 1: Guide to Transmigration and Self-Preservation

A rusted steel bar pierced through the man's chest, and wet blood dripped down along the metal.

The man stared at the person right in front of him in disbelief, collapsed to the ground, struggled twice, and then went still, his body twitching before falling silent.

Seeing that the man was dead, the youth casually wiped the blood off his arm.

"T-t-this... this was the first human you've encountered in The Apocalypse, and you just killed him like that?!"

The surprised voice of system 111 echoed in his mind.

"If I didn't kill him, my pants would have been pulled down."

Su Han adjusted his clothes, feeling disgusted.

Today was his seventh day since transmigrating into the book, and also his seventh day struggling to survive in The Apocalypse.

Although he hadn't found a chance to see his own face clearly, his limbs were slender and his skin fair, so he likely looked quite decent.

In an era like The Apocalypse, where morality had collapsed and order was lost, such an appearance was the most fatal trait.

Su Han sighed and kicked the corpse.

There was no other way; he had to survive.

He had transmigrated into a male-oriented novel titled "Apocalyptic Destruction Guide," which was rumored to be the author's revenge-fueled work.

The male lead, Shen Chengyin, was the eldest son of the Shen family. As a child, he was swapped by a servant and sent to an orphanage, leading to a miserable childhood. In The Apocalypse, he was betrayed by friends and family one after another, suffering both physical and mental abuse.

In the end, this favored son of heaven was forced to detonate himself to destroy the world, and only then did it end.

To survive, he had to find a way to change the plot line and prevent the male lead from turning evil.

But the biggest problem now wasโ€”where was the male lead?

He had been struggling in The Apocalypse for a week, and the sleazy middle-aged man who tried to pull his pants down was the first living person he had encountered.

"According to the plot, the male lead established 'Xiwang Base' (Hope Base) at the beginning of The Apocalypse and became its leader. But it has already been three months since The Apocalypse began..."

system 111 trailed off.

Su Han took a deep breath; his future looked bleak.

Three months into The Apocalypse was exactly the time when the Xiwang Base, where the male lead resided, experienced its first large-scale zombie siege.

It was also at this time that the male lead was seriously injured, betrayed by friends and family, had his chest cut open and drained of blood, and was thrown out of the city gates, left on the verge of death.

This was the first step in the male lead's descent into darkness.

Hopefully, he could still make it in time.

Su Han scavenged some useful supplies from the man's body, stuffed them into his backpack, and then found a place to hide.

People who could live well three months into The Apocalypse were either exceptionally skilled or had accomplices to help them.

The middle-aged man was short and fat, so he preferred to believe the latter.

Not long after, two young men holding weapons stumbled over. Upon seeing the corpse on the ground, their eyes immediately turned red.

"Uncle Wangโ€”!"

The other person pulled him back and shook his head, "He's gone. Let's hurry back to the base. Today is the ceremony for the deputy leader's confirmation; if we go back late, we won't even get a piece of meat."

The two quickly composed themselves and returned to their vehicle.

The vehicle slowly drove away, and Su Han cautiously followed behind.

Half an hour later, the group finally arrived at Xiwang Base. The vehicle passed security and entered the city gates, while Su Han could only pace outside.

In the original text, the male lead awakened his Spatial Ability early in The Apocalypse and relied on the abundant supplies within his space to become a base leader who protected the people.

During the first zombie siege, the male lead was seriously injured while protecting his brothers, but they kicked him while he was down, forcing him to his death to extract the supplies from his space.

Su Han hid outside the city for nearly two hours before he finally saw a group of people on the city wall throw a dark mass down.

Several zombies approached at the sound, feasting on the dark mass.

The group on the city wall laughed and giggled, staring at the dark mass for a while before leaving.

After the group left, Su Han immediately approached and silently decapitated the few zombies with his knife.

However, when he got closer, he couldn't help but gasp.

Before him was a mass of rotting flesh that vaguely resembled a human shape, gnawed almost entirely by zombies. His chest had been sliced open by a sharp blade, exposing the ribs and internal organs inside.

If not for the heart exposed to the air, which still twitched every now and then, he would have truly thought the male lead was dead.

Everyone in this city was someone the male lead had protected with his life, yet he ended up with such an outcome.

Su Han's nose stung. He picked the person up and retreated into the distant dense forest at high speed.

Large bases constantly attracted zombies and were not suitable for long stays. Given Su Han's physical stamina, he couldn't run too far either.

He took off his jacket, covered the male lead with it, and sat down in a sheltered spot behind the mountain.

From beginning to end, he didn't dare to lift the clothes to look at the male lead.

After all, that sight... was simply too bloody.

Time ticked by, and the clothes covering the male lead's body remained motionless. Su Han was truly worried and raised his hand to lift a corner of the jacket.

He saw the male lead's heart, twitching irregularly and slowly within his chest.

He didn't know if it was his imagination, but the twitching seemed to be getting slower and slower...

One beat, two beats.

"...Hey, the heartbeat seems to have stopped."

It wasn't until system 111 spoke that Su Han snapped back to reality.

The person before him was completely dead, turned into a cold corpse.

He searched the body in disbelief; it was just a pile of rotting flesh, no different from the pork at a butcher's stall.

"Shen Chengyin!"

"Shen Chengyin! Don't die!"

Su Han's mind went blank.

It was over. The male lead was dead. The mission had failed before it even started.

He didn't want to stay in this zombie-infested world forever!

"Are you crazy! Yelling so loudly will attract zombies!" system 111 warned urgently.

Zombies had degraded vision and smell, but their hearing had become acute. Usually, to avoid zombies, Su Han moved very lightly.

Su Han also realized he had lost his composure and immediately entered a state of alert.

But it was already too late.

Before his hand could grab the knife on the ground, a roar sounded right by his ear.

Su Han had to give up on grabbing the knife and rolled to the side.

A Primary Zombie lunged, missing Su Han by a hair's breadth as it brushed against his arm.

A Primary Zombie had speed and strength that were even more freakish than ordinary zombies (which don't have any level yet).

It was very difficult for Su Han to deal with it alone, especially since he hadn't retrieved his weapon, leaving him in a very passive position.

After failing its first strike, the zombie immediately turned and pinned Su Han to the ground.

Rotting skin mixed with slime dripped onto Su Han's face. He used all his strength to grab the zombie's neck and pushed outward with all his might.

He didn't want to die!

The Primary Zombie had great strength, and Su Han's arm was forced to bend inch by inch.

If this continued, his arm would break.

He struggled with all his might to the side, preparing to roll over. Just then, a squelching sound suddenly came to his ears, and immediately, the pressure on his hands vanished.

The Primary Zombie's head had been severed by something, and it rolled to the side.

He panted heavily, staring at the weapon that had severed the zombie's head.

It was the very machete he hadn't been able to pick up just a moment ago.

Su Han kicked the zombie's corpse away, and in the next second, he saw a figure standing before him.

The figure was draped in his jacket, and his expression was unclear. One could only See a pair of scarlet, sinister eyes hidden amidst messy black hair.

That gaze clearly indicated an intent to kill him.
